Iran’s steel consumption decreases despite growing output

In the first quarter of the Iranian calendar – April-June 2021 – Iranian apparent finished steel consumption decreased by 2% on-year and semi-finished steel by 1%, but direct reduced iron output grew by 4%, Kallanish notes.
